Smaller Parks
With over 240 parks in Vancouver, there is plenty of green space to explore! And, as much as we love Stanley Park and Trout Lake, there are some other hidden gems too. Our favourites: Choklit Park on 7th (a small park, with big views; and the former location of Purdy's Chocolate factory, hence the name!), the little park behind Roedde House Museum off Barclay in the West End (nice, quiet spot to read a book) and China Creek Park at 10th and Clark (filled with big, shady trees and lively playground and skate park).
